Job Summary

Delivers coordinated nursing care for patients in the Emergency Department, supervising assigned staff and coordinating with multidisciplinary teams. Collects and analyzes assessment data to determine diagnoses, develops intervention plans, and implements strategies to promote a safe environment. Collaborates with patients and families to provide health information and learning opportunities, while participating in discharge planning to ensure continuity of care. Delegates duties appropriately and performs other job-related tasks as assigned. Requires BSN, RN licensure, ACLS/ALS certification, and experience in acute care settings.
